This is my number one tip for a reason! A full belly helps baby relax, and it works wonders for toddlers and parents too! Feeding your newborn just before I arrive can help them feel settled or sleepy (which is perfect for cozy snuggly photos).
If you have older kiddos, a quick snack before we start can help avoid meltdowns and keep spirits high. And don’t worry, we can pause anytime for a feeding or cuddle break. Your baby and other kiddos in the family set the pace.
Babies love being warm, especially if we’re doing some photos with them swaddled or in just a diaper. If your session is during colder months, turning up the heat a little or using a space heater in the room we’ll be in can make a big difference in keeping baby content.
It also helps everyone else feel a little cozier, which translates beautifully into relaxed, love-soaked images.
You don’t need to overthink wardrobe, but it’s helpful to have a few options ready! For baby, soft, simple outfits or sleepers in neutral tones photograph really well. Swaddles and blankets are great to have on hand too.
For the rest of the family, I always suggest outfits that feel good to wear and coordinate well together. Think soft tones, comfy fabrics, and styles you can move and snuggle in. Toddlers do what toddlers do. Babies cry. Dogs bark. Laundry piles exist. That’s real life, and that’s where the magic is! Some of my favourite images come from unscripted, unexpected moments.
You don’t have to clean your whole house, you don’t need everyone to “behave,” and you definitely don’t need to stress. My sessions are relaxed, and I’ll gently guide when needed, but my goal is to capture you as you really are, in all the beautiful, messy, love filled ways that matter most.
